KABW (95.1FM) is acountry musicradio station, licensed toBaird, Texas, a town nearAbilene, Texas.[2] KABW's on-air personalities include Wolf Mornings with Kate & Kaden, Lisa Thomas, Randy Brooks.[3]
On September 11, 2012, KORQ's Callsign changed KABW and its format changed fromCHR to country.[7]
